Problems solved by technology

[0004] Fabrics on the surface of furniture need to be sterilized during the production process to avoid mildew on the fabrics during the long-term stacking process. The current effective treatment method is to use steam to sterilize. Due to the low temperature of the surface wall of the fabric, steam sterilization process will When the steam is liquefied when it is cold, the humidity of the fabric will increase greatly, and the subsequent drying process will be slow, reducing the overall processing efficiency of the fabric

Abstract

The invention belongs to the technical field of cloth production and processing, particularly relates to a steam sterilization device for furniture surface cloth production, and aims to solve the problems that the humidity of cloth is greatly increased, the follow-up drying process is slow, and the overall treatment efficiency of the cloth is reduced due to the fact that the surface wall temperature of the cloth is relatively low and steam is liquefied when cooled in the steam sterilization process. According to the scheme, the device comprises an outer box, a semicircular base is fixedly connected to the inner wall of the bottom of the outer box, a lamp box is fixedly connected between the inner walls of the two sides of the semicircular base, a plurality of grooves are circumferentially formed in the outer wall of the lamp box at equal intervals, and an infrared lamp tube is fixedly connected between the inner walls of the two sides of each groove. Cloth before steam sterilization is heated through the infrared lamp tubes, the temperature of the cloth is increased, and the situation that in the subsequent steam sterilization process, due to the fact that a large amount of steam is condensed and liquefied due to the low temperature of the surface of the cloth, the humidity of the cloth is greatly increased, the drying time after steam sterilization is prolonged, and the treatment efficiency of the cloth is reduced is avoided.
